About MetLife, Inc.

About MetLife, Inc.

MetLife restructured into six reportable segments in Q4 2025 — Group Benefits, Retirement and Income Solutions (RIS), Asia, Latin America, EMEA, and MetLife Investment Management (MIM) — after the Strategic Reorganization added MIM as a standalone unit and removed MetLife Holdings as a separate segment. MIM completed the acquisition of PineBridge Investments on December 30, 2025, a global asset manager. MetLife holds market positions in the U.S., Asia, Latin America, Europe, and the Middle East, selling to corporations, government entities, and individuals.

MetLife's revenue spans net investment income from a general account invested primarily in fixed income securities, corporate and structured credit, mortgage loans, real estate, and alternative investments; premium income from Group Benefits (life, dental, short- and long-term disability, accident and health, vision); annuity income from RIS products including pension risk transfers and stable value guaranteed investment contracts; and fee income from MIM's institutional asset management services offered to insurance companies, pension plans, sovereign wealth funds, and endowments. Group Benefits distributes through MetLife employees targeting large employers, and the company also provides group life and benefit coverage to U.S. Government employees. MIM markets through a proprietary institutional sales force. The company's largest Asia operation is in Japan; in Latin America, Mexico and Chile represent the largest markets.

MetLife's fixed income-heavy general account creates material interest rate sensitivity in both directions. Rising rates may trigger policyholder surrenders and require more-frequent collateral posting on cleared swaps, while falling rates compress investment spread and may require reserve increases. The New York insurance regulator's annual SCL for year-end asset adequacy testing may impose unforeseen reserve assumptions affecting statutory capital, as disclosed explicitly in Item 1A — a tail risk layered on top of the company's broader interest rate asset-liability mismatch exposure.
